Panna Ki Pasand

INGREDIENTS

2 cups green peas, shelled, boiled and crushed
1 tsp. green chili-ginger paste
1/4 tsp. ground black pepper
Salt, to taste
3 cups wheat flour
A little water
1 cup chopped coriander leaves
Oil, for frying

INSTRUCTIONS

Mix all the ingredients into a sticky dough. Pat the dough, using oiled fingers, on a greased warm tava. Dribble 2 tbsp. oil around, cover and cook on a slow fire. When you get a sizzling sound, turn it over and cook on the other side. Dribble some more oil, if necessary. Serve hot.

CHEF COMMENTS

You can use a plastic sheet to pat on the dough before transferring it onto a hot tava.
